2013 was a great year for the English company Oakley Design. A lot of their cars were spotted and they will come up with some new cars this year. During spring, the Lamborghini Huracán LP610-4 will probably be ready but that's not all. Soon, Oakley Design will introduce the Ferrrari FF.

Oakley Design aims for a maximum result with minimal changes. The English tuner passionately tunes Italian supercars but they try not to influence the exterior. Spoilers always have a function, better performance. This is exactly the same with the package they've developed for the FF. Oakley Design developed a carbon fiber package which creates more downforce, especially at high speeds. More stability is also important for those who want to use the maximum of the Ferrari's V12. Beautiful 21 inch HRE-Performance wheels finish the car.

The V12 in front is tuned and gets at least an extra 20 or 30 hp. With this extra power, the FF is getting close to the 700 hp strong Aventador by Lamborghini. The improved performance is presented during the Autorsport International event in Birmingham. Until recently, you could only visit Novitec Rosso for a more sporty Ferrari FF. Soon, this will change.
